ruby-on-rails - datetime_select 上的值为零?

标签 ruby-on-rails

当将 <%= f.datetime_select :start %> 用于"new"对象表单时,如何设置选项以不选择默认日期而是选择 nil/null 值?相关模型中的字段可以选择为空,但默认情况下 datetime_select 控件没有空选项。

最佳答案

我想你想要:
f.datetime_select :start, :include_blank => true
start为零,字段将选择空白选项。这也允许用户不输入日期。

the documentation for date_select详情。

关于ruby-on-rails - datetime_select 上的值为零?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/559584/

相关文章:

javascript - Rails Assets 在生产中不可用

ruby-on-rails - Rails 新闻过滤器 url seo

ruby-on-rails - 未定义的方法 `each' 为 "#<Complaigns::ActiveRecord_Relation:0x00000003cfb4c8>":String

ruby-on-rails - Ruby函数将两个字符串合并为一个

jquery - 在 rails 中通过 remote_function 中的表单生成器?

mysql - Rails 4 连接关联表 - 当某些记录没有关联时进行排序

sql - 使用 JOIN 和 LIKE 的 Rails OR 查询

ruby-on-rails - 使用 private_pub gem 时出现 "BUG segmentation fault"

ruby-on-rails - 名称修复/验证?

ruby-on-rails - Rails 批量赋值和 Backbone.js